Castro & Company is an audit, advisory, and accounting services CPA Firm specializing in providing the personalized services of a small firm with the full resources and quality expected from a larger CPA firm. We are minority-owned and located in the Washington, DC metropolitan area. Castro & Company holds certifications for Federal contracting under the Small Business Administration Certification 8(a) Business Development (BD) and Small Disadvantaged Business (SDB) Program. Additionally, the firm holds a GSA Financial and Business Solutions (FABS) Schedule GS-23F-0038U.
